Mobile Access


Diners using the iPhone now have a new alphabetic search facility to make finding and commenting on eating places even easier. The new function is accessed by clicking on the "Alphabetic" button now displayed on the search results screen. This enables users to filter their results by the first letter of the Establishment Name. Clicking on the "Basic" button returns you to the original results list. This facility is particularly useful when you are the first person to comment on an Establishment as, currently, results are ordered by "most Recommended" first.

YORKSHIRE HAS SPOKEN                               sandwich1.jpg
Following an online campaign that has seen Yorkshire folk voting for their favourite sandwich filling since National Bread Week back in April, the winner has finally been announced. The competition, which was conducted entirely on Facebook, attracted more than 50 suggestions and hundreds of votes from sarnie fans across the county and beyond, who all decided that bacon and egg sandwiched between soft slices of Yorkshire’s Champion would be their Ultimate Yorkshire Sandwich.  More...
